World Cancer Day 2021

World Cancer Day takes place on 4 February every year with the aim of raising awareness and improving education to reduce the devastating impact of cancer has on people across the world.

Here at It’s good 2 give we are very aware of the impact cancer has on young people and their families.

What We Do

That’s where we hope to make a difference, by helping with some of the ‘practical things’ so they can focus on each other and what’s important.

We provide nutritional snacks for young people in hospital and their parents, toiletry packs for when there’s no time to pick up supplies, shopping vouchers for families isolated by Covid-19 and our Ripple Retreat offers a space for families to spend time together in a safe environment. We also support specific requests from staff for the families.
